Handover note — Crumbwheel order cutoffs.

Welcome aboard. The bakery cutoff rule in Crumbwheel closes same-day orders at 14:00 local to each storefront, not UTC — this has bitten us twice. Holiday overrides live in the calendar service and take precedence silently, so always check there first when a cutoff looks wrong. To unlock the calendar service's admin console after a restart, enter the recovery passphrase below.

vault phrase of bagap-bahaf = silion-pelox-sorox-casdor-quenwyn-fraax-eliox-praael-kelion-quenvan-kasox-rusael-norius-belvan

Ticket: Schemadex registry failing validation in staging. Root cause: env file from the old cluster was copied verbatim; endpoint points at the decommissioned broker and compatibility mode is set to NONE instead of BACKWARD. Producers are publishing unchecked events as a result. Fix before cutting 4.2: correct the broker endpoint, restore BACKWARD mode, and rotate the registry credential since the old one shipped in a build artifact. The replacement credential goes on the next line.

vault entry, yahif-yajep: COURIER_KEY29=b802bdf8034096b65a51c6ba5abe2

## Runbook: Fare-Split Pricing Experiment Rollout

Support team: the Fare-Split experiment on the Quillgate ticketing platform goes live Tuesday at 09:00. Affected users may see two price variants; both are intentional. Do not issue refunds for variant differences under 5%. If a customer reports a checkout error, check the experiment flag dashboard before escalating. Hotfix bundles for this experiment are pre-signed by the release team, and artifacts must validate against the key below.

deploy key for kajof-fajop: bky6_gDHw9Q

Root cause: the refresh worker was deployed with the production issuer URL but a staging-only signing credential, so refreshed tokens fail verification downstream. Impact is limited to staging, but the pattern is worth a security review since the mismatch was silent for nine days. Remediation is to align the env file with the staging issuer and rotate the credential. The corrected env file should include the line below.

env line for yahag-kajog: VAULT_KEY13=e1c568d90102d